Narrative:

We first noted a problem on taxi out from the fat gate. The lower rudder showed only slight movement during the flight control check. All other flight controls checked normal. We asked fat ground control for a place to park the aircraft in order to investigate a potential problem. After the aircraft was parked and brakes set, captain asked me to refer to the appropriate pom abnormal checklist. I found nothing applicable in the hydraulic or flight control sections. He then asked me to refer to the appropriate sections of the prm. After discussions, he asked me to pull and reset 4 yaw damper rudder circuit breakers on the P-18-1 panel with no apparent results. He then asked me to pull and reset the rudder shutoff valve circuit breaker on the lower P-6 panel. We then turned off the system a hydraulic pumps and simultaneously actuated the flight controls in an effort to shock the system with no positive results. He then turned on the standby rudder and on checking rudder movement, noted normal full simultaneous deflection of both upper and lower rudder indices. During this period, we noted that the rudder system a low pressure light was illuminated. We then cycled the system a fluid shutoff switches. Pressures and quantities continued normal throughout. We then checked the MEL under hydraulics and lower rudder and found nothing applicable to this problem. We then called flight control and asked for the maintenance coordinator. We informed him of the aforementioned problem. The maintenance coordinator asked the crew to turn off system a pumps and also to check the standby system to see if it would work. Although we had already accomplished this, we tried it again. The maintenance coordinator then suggested that the second officer go to the 48-section and check the system a cannon plugs on the left sidewall by the aft airstair. I did this by physically assuring that they were seated securely. While I was performing these checks the maintenance coordinator cleared the frequency for other company usage. A few minutes later we called back the maintenance coordinator to inform him that this did not help. During this time 2 PA's were made to the passenger to keep them informed. At this time, atlanta strongly suggested that we continue the departure and re-file en route to lax. Our other option was to return to the gate and cancel. Desiring to fly the normal schedule, we asked if we could either have maintenance fly to fat or if contract maintenance was available. After further discussion, with the maintenance coordinator and being fully assured that full rudder operation was available with use of standby rudder, captain felt it was safe to continue the flight. At this point, we informed the passenger that the flight would continue with a stop in lax. On hearing this, a passenger became somewhat upset because he needed to get to reno in order to make connections for lake tahoe. This produced some confusion as the passenger needed to be consoled and assured he and the majority of passengers would best be accommodated in this manner. Captain then rechecked with flight control to assure that this course of action was in the best interests of all passengers. Flight control assured me that this was so, but that it was his option to either go to lax or return to the gate and cancel the flight. We then completed all checklists and notified ground we were ready to continue. We switched to tower and were released for takeoff. On departure, we asked for a clearance to lax. Callback conversation with reporter revealed the following: reporter gave analyst the impression that he was upset by the decision to fly the airplane with the rudder problem. He was evasive as to who actually made the decision to go. He said he has not heard a thing about what the problem with the airplane was. He also said that the matter still is not over, that there was some action being taken. He was not specific as to whether it was the company, the FAA or both conducting the investigation.
